Ministry of Interior Honours Retired Officers at Abuja Send-Forth

The Ministry of Interior has honoured officers who recently retired from public service, recognising their years of commitment and contributions to the Federal Government.

The event, held in Abuja, brought together senior officials and staff of the ministry to celebrate the retirees’ careers and service record. The Honourable Minister of Interior, Olubunmi Tunji-Ojo, was represented at the ceremony by the Permanent Secretary, Magdalene Ajani.

Speaking on behalf of the minister, Dr. Ajani described the retired officers as key contributors to the ministry’s institutional growth, noting that their dedication and professionalism had helped strengthen public service delivery over the years. She added that their influence would continue to be felt beyond active service.

According to her, retirement does not diminish the relevance of experienced officers, stressing that the ministry would continue to draw from their knowledge and institutional memory when necessary.

The Director of Human Resource Management, Catherine N. Zosi, also commended the retirees, describing their service records as exemplary and worthy of emulation by younger officers within the ministry.

She noted that the values of discipline, integrity, and mentorship demonstrated by the retirees had contributed significantly to sustaining professionalism in the ministry.

The send-forth ceremony featured goodwill messages from colleagues and retirees, as well as the presentation of commendation certificates and gifts in recognition of the officers’ service to the nation.
